Performance Characteristics of Plastic Nylon Gears
Plastic nylon gears exhibit several performance characteristics that make them suitable for various applications:
- High strength and durability: Plastic nylon gears have excellent strength and can withstand heavy loads.
- Low friction and noise: Due to their self-lubricating properties, plastic nylon gears operate smoothly with minimal noise.
- Chemical resistance: Plastic nylon gears are resistant to various chemicals, making them suitable for harsh environments.
- Lightweight: Compared to metal gears, plastic nylon gears are lightweight, making them ideal for applications where weight reduction is crucial.
- Cost-effective: Plastic nylon gears are relatively inexpensive compared to other gear materials, making them a cost-effective choice for many industries.

Maintenance of Plastic Nylon Gears
Proper maintenance of plastic nylon gears is essential for optimal performance and longevity. Some maintenance practices include:
- Regular equipment inspections to identify any signs of wear, damage, or misalignment.
- Cleaning and corrosion prevention to protect the gears from contaminants and environmental factors.
- Lubrication and proper gear alignment to minimize friction and ensure smooth operation.
- Timely replacement of worn-out gear components to prevent performance degradation.

Q: Are plastic nylon gears suitable for high-temperature applications?
A: Plastic nylon gears have good heat resistance but may not be suitable for extremely high-temperature environments. It is important to choose the appropriate nylon material based on the specific temperature requirements.
